MPMT2002DT0 Description
MPMT2002DT0 Description
The MPMT2002DT0 from Vishay is a high-precision thin-film resistor network designed for demanding surface-mount applications. This dual-resistor network features two 10K Ohm resistors with a tight 0.5% tolerance and a low ±25ppm/°C temperature coefficient, ensuring stable performance across a wide operating temperature range (-70°C to +150°C derated, up to +125°C at full power). Encased in a molded SOT-23 (3-pin) package with gull-wing terminations, it offers excellent reliability in compact PCB layouts. The device is RoHS compliant and supplied in tape-and-reel packaging for automated assembly.
MPMT2002DT0 Features
- Precision Thin Film Technology: Delivers superior accuracy (±0.5%) and low TCR (±25ppm/°C) for stable signal conditioning.
- Robust Power Handling: 0.2W (1/5W) total power rating (0.1W per resistor) with a 100V maximum voltage rating.
- Compact & Reliable: 3.05mm x 2.5mm x 1.12mm molded package withstands harsh environments.
- Automation-Friendly: Gull-wing leads and tape-and-reel packaging streamline high-volume SMT processes.
- Wide Temperature Range: Operates from -70°C to +150°C (derated) with full performance up to +125°C.
MPMT2002DT0 Applications
- Voltage Dividers: Ideal for VOLT/D circuit designators in precision analog circuits.
- Sensor Signal Conditioning: Used in temperature sensors, strain gauges, and bridge networks due to low TCR.
- Portable Electronics: Space-constrained devices like wearables, IoT modules, and medical sensors benefit from its compact footprint.
- Industrial Controls: Reliable performance in PLC modules, motor drives, and power management systems.
- Automotive (Non-Automotive Grade): Suitable for non-safety-critical applications like infotainment or lighting.
